What is an Autonomous Chair?
An autonomous chair is a smart piece of furniture that uses sensors and AI to adjust itself. It can detect your body’s position and make automatic changes. These changes aim to provide the best possible support and comfort. Think of it as a chair that thinks for itself to help you.
This chair is designed to reduce physical strain during long study sessions. It moves with you, offering continuous ergonomic benefits. The goal is to prevent discomfort and promote better posture without you having to constantly readjust.

The Evolution of Seating for Productivity
Historically, chairs were simple. They offered basic support but lacked any dynamic features. Over time, ergonomic chairs emerged. These chairs allowed manual adjustments for height, armrests, and back support.
The concept of an “autonomous chair” takes this further. It moves beyond manual adjustments. It uses technology to anticipate and respond to your body’s needs in real-time. This represents a significant leap in furniture design for productivity.
Key Features of an Autonomous Chair for Students
An autonomous chair boasts several advanced features. These are specifically beneficial for students.
Smart Posture Detection
This chair uses sensors to understand how you are sitting. It can detect if you’re slouching or leaning too far forward. It then gently adjusts to guide you back into a healthy posture. This helps prevent back pain and improves spinal alignment.
Dynamic Lumbar Support
Unlike static lumbar support, this feature moves with you. As you shift or change positions, the chair’s lumbar support adapts. It ensures your lower back is always cradled correctly. This is essential for long hours of sitting.
Personalized Comfort Settings
You can often set your preferences. The chair learns what feels most comfortable for you. It can store these settings for different users or tasks. This means your chair is always set up perfectly.
Integrated Cooling and Heating
Some advanced models might include climate control. They can gently warm or cool the seat and backrest. This helps you stay comfortable regardless of the room temperature. It prevents overheating or feeling too cold.
Automated Height and Angle Adjustments
The chair can automatically adjust its height and tilt. This happens based on your body weight and posture. It ensures you maintain an optimal desk height. This also helps in reducing pressure on your legs.

Autonomous Chair vs. Traditional Ergonomic Chairs
While traditional ergonomic chairs offer improvements, autonomous chairs offer a new level of smart functionality.
| Feature | Traditional Ergonomic Chair | Autonomous Chair |
| :———————– | :——————————————————– | :————————————————————— |
| Adjustment Type | Manual (user-controlled levers and knobs) | Automatic (sensor-driven, AI-powered) |
| Support | Static or manually adjustable | Dynamic, responsive to user movement |
| Posture Correction | Relies on user awareness and manual adjustments | Actively guides and corrects posture automatically |
| Personalization | User sets preferences manually | Learns and adapts to individual user needs over time |
| Technological Integration | Minimal | Advanced sensors, AI, potentially climate control |
| User Effort | Requires active user input for optimal settings | Minimal user effort; chair does the work |
Traditional ergonomic chairs are a good starting point. They allow for customization. However, they require you to know how to adjust them correctly. An autonomous chair simplifies this. It does the work for you.
